#9b003c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9b003c is composed of 60.8% red, 0%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 61.3%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 336.8 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 30.4%. #9b003c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0078 with #370000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#9b003c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9b003c has RGB values of R:155, G:0,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.61,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10158140.

Shades and Tints of #9b003c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120007 is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.
